Move all lua related files to lua/ subfolder
Also remove the lexers sub directory from the Lua search path. As a result we attempt to open fewer files during startup: $ strace -e open -o log ./vis +q config.h && wc -l log In order to avoid having to modifiy all lexers which `require('lexer')` we instead place a symlink in the top level directory. $ ./configure --disable-lua $ rm -rf lua Should result in a source tree with most lua specifc functionality removed.

--- Copyright 2006-2016 Mitchell mitchell.att.foicica.com. See LICENSE.
--- Fortran LPeg lexer.
-
-local l = require('lexer')
-local token, word_match = l.token, l.word_match
-local P, R, S = lpeg.P, lpeg.R, lpeg.S
-
-local M = {_NAME = 'fortran'}
-
--- Whitespace.
-local ws = token(l.WHITESPACE, l.space^1)
-
--- Comments.
-local c_comment = l.starts_line(S('Cc')) * l.nonnewline^0
-local d_comment = l.starts_line(S('Dd')) * l.nonnewline^0
-local ex_comment = l.starts_line('!') * l.nonnewline^0
-local ast_comment = l.starts_line('*') * l.nonnewline^0
-local line_comment = '!' * l.nonnewline^0
-local comment = token(l.COMMENT, c_comment + d_comment + ex_comment +
- ast_comment + line_comment)
-
--- Strings.
-local sq_str = l.delimited_range("'", true, true)
-local dq_str = l.delimited_range('"', true, true)
-local string = token(l.STRING, sq_str + dq_str)
-
--- Numbers.
-local number = token(l.NUMBER, (l.float + l.integer) * -l.alpha)
-
--- Keywords.
-local keyword = token(l.KEYWORD, word_match({
- 'include', 'program', 'module', 'subroutine', 'function', 'contains', 'use',
- 'call', 'return',
- -- Statements.
- 'case', 'select', 'default', 'continue', 'cycle', 'do', 'while', 'else', 'if',
- 'elseif', 'then', 'elsewhere', 'end', 'endif', 'enddo', 'forall', 'where',
- 'exit', 'goto', 'pause', 'stop',
- -- Operators.
- '.not.', '.and.', '.or.', '.xor.', '.eqv.', '.neqv.', '.eq.', '.ne.', '.gt.',
- '.ge.', '.lt.', '.le.',
- -- Logical.
- '.false.', '.true.'
-}, '.', true))
-
--- Functions.
-local func = token(l.FUNCTION, word_match({
- -- I/O.
- 'backspace', 'close', 'endfile', 'inquire', 'open', 'print', 'read', 'rewind',
- 'write', 'format',
- -- Type conversion, utility, and math.
- 'aimag', 'aint', 'amax0', 'amin0', 'anint', 'ceiling', 'cmplx', 'conjg',
- 'dble', 'dcmplx', 'dfloat', 'dim', 'dprod', 'float', 'floor', 'ifix', 'imag',
- 'int', 'logical', 'modulo', 'nint', 'real', 'sign', 'sngl', 'transfer',
- 'zext', 'abs', 'acos', 'aimag', 'aint', 'alog', 'alog10', 'amax0', 'amax1',
- 'amin0', 'amin1', 'amod', 'anint', 'asin', 'atan', 'atan2', 'cabs', 'ccos',
- 'char', 'clog', 'cmplx', 'conjg', 'cos', 'cosh', 'csin', 'csqrt', 'dabs',
- 'dacos', 'dasin', 'datan', 'datan2', 'dble', 'dcos', 'dcosh', 'ddim', 'dexp',
- 'dim', 'dint', 'dlog', 'dlog10', 'dmax1', 'dmin1', 'dmod', 'dnint', 'dprod',
- 'dreal', 'dsign', 'dsin', 'dsinh', 'dsqrt', 'dtan', 'dtanh', 'exp', 'float',
- 'iabs', 'ichar', 'idim', 'idint', 'idnint', 'ifix', 'index', 'int', 'isign',
- 'len', 'lge', 'lgt', 'lle', 'llt', 'log', 'log10', 'max', 'max0', 'max1',
- 'min', 'min0', 'min1', 'mod', 'nint', 'real', 'sign', 'sin', 'sinh', 'sngl',
- 'sqrt', 'tan', 'tanh'
-}, nil, true))
-
--- Types.
-local type = token(l.TYPE, word_match({
- 'implicit', 'explicit', 'none', 'data', 'parameter', 'allocate',
- 'allocatable', 'allocated', 'deallocate', 'integer', 'real', 'double',
- 'precision', 'complex', 'logical', 'character', 'dimension', 'kind',
-}, nil, true))
-
--- Identifiers.
-local identifier = token(l.IDENTIFIER, l.alnum^1)
-
--- Operators.
-local operator = token(l.OPERATOR, S('<>=&+-/*,()'))
-
-M._rules = {
- {'whitespace', ws},
- {'comment', comment},
- {'keyword', keyword},
- {'function', func},
- {'type', type},
- {'number', number},
- {'identifier', identifier},
- {'string', string},
- {'operator', operator},
-}
-
-return M
